Chandlers Ford train station is equipped to handle the busy flux of everyday train-goers. The station sports ticket machines that are accessible and equipped with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, although it does not issue smartcards. You can conveniently collect pre-purchased tickets at the machine. The ticket office opens from 06:10 to 12:30 on weekdays and 07:10 to 13:30 on Saturdays, while remaining closed on Sundays.
There is a focus on accessibility at Chandlers Ford station. With step-free access across the station, it ensures smooth movement for all travelers. Accessible toilets operated by radar key are within the booking hall and are available during ticket office hours. While there are no dedicated passenger assistance staff at the station, help can be availed from the Guard on-board the train, without prior booking necessary.
For those looking to travel beyond the tracks, Chandlers Ford provides excellent transport connectivity. Regular local bus services operate from the precinct bus stop located at Bournemouth Road and Hurley Road, ensuring seamless onward travel. The station's bicycle parking area is generous too, featuring 62 spaces including 9 lockers and 53 stand spaces. While there are no on-site shops or refreshment facilities, public Wi-Fi is available to keep you connected as you wait.
The availability of free car parking with 45 spaces, including two accessible ones, adds to the station's convenience. There are no explicit charges for Blue Badge holders, given a valid permit is clearly displayed as per the rules.

Tooting Station is equipped with essential facilities designed to make your journey as smooth as possible. While it may not boast over-the-top luxury, it certainly covers the basics efficiently.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with a ticket office open during morning and evening peak hours on weekdays and throughout the day on Saturday; there are also ticket machines for swift service. However, it's important to note that accessible ticket machines are not available. If you've purchased your tickets online, you can easily collect them at the ticket machine on the premises.
For additional support, the station offers customer information through help points and displays departure screens to keep travelers informed. Although there isn't a waiting room or lounge, seating areas are available to provide some comfort while you wait for your train. If you need to store your bicycle, the station has spaces with CCTV coverage located conveniently near the entrance, though bicycle hire is not available at this site.
Travelers looking to explore the city further will find Tooting's links to other modes of transport quite handy. While taxi services are not directly available at the station, the comprehensive bus network ensures you're well connected. Additionally, resources such as the 'Onward Travel Information Map’ available at the station make planning your next steps hassle-free. During significant rail disruptions, it’s good to know that a rail replacement service can facilitate your journey.
Unfortunately, Tooting Station does face some accessibility limitations, marked as a Category C station with no step-free access. Assistance is on hand during staffed hours, and you can pre-arrange travel support to make your trip as comfortable as possible. Those needing special assistance should note that the station doesn't have accessible toilets, and the absence of a waiting room could hinder comfort for some travelers.
